Overview

Tori Glen is an image consultant for the three wealthy and successful brothers who own Thurston-Hughes Inc. She loves her job and admires Oliver, Rory, and Callum from afar, knowing they’re out of her league.

But one night, Tori finds a heartbroken Oliver and can’t resist the temptation to comfort him. However, when Oliver rejects her the next day, Tori resigns, prompting Rory and Callum to realize that they need to do something to save their brother.

They hatch a desperate plan to seduce Tori and make her the center of their unconventional family. As they awaken Tori’s senses, they must also deal with Oliver’s regret and the threat of a vengeful stranger.

Can the brothers come together to protect the woman they love and defeat their enemy, or will their unconventional family lead them to murder? Find out in Their Virgin Mistress by Shayla Black.

About the Author

Shayla Black has made a name for herself as a bestselling author, with over ninety published books in various genres including contemporary, erotic, paranormal, and historical romances. Her books have been translated into multiple languages and have sold millions of copies around the world.

Growing up as an only child, Shayla found solace in her daydreams, much to the annoyance of her teachers. During her college years, she discovered her love for reading and began pursuing a career in publishing.

After graduating with a degree in Marketing/Advertising, she briefly worked in corporate America, but eventually decided to follow her passion for writing and create stories and characters that would capture readers’ hearts.

Shayla now lives in North Texas with her husband, daughter, and two beloved cats. When she’s not writing, she enjoys indulging in reality TV, gaming, and listening to a diverse range of music.
